- 1). Launch the After Effects installer. If you purchased a hard copy of the software, insert the disc into your drive and the installer will launch automatically. If you downloaded your software, locate the file and double-click its icon. Select a location for the temporary installation files, then click "Next." Extraction of the temporary files takes several minutes.
- 2). Enter your serial number. Provide your unique 24-digit serial number in the appropriate fields. If you want to install After Effects as trial software, select the corresponding button on the right-hand side of the screen. For either method, click "Next."
- 3). Accept the license agreement. Review the text of the agreement, then click "Accept."
- 4). Select the installation location and other options. Click the "Change" button on the left-hand side of the screen to change the default After Effects installation location if your needs require it. Scroll down the list of additional programs on the right-hand side of the screen and place a check in the box next to every program you wish to install along with After Effects.
- 5). Install After Effects CS3. Click the "Install" button when you are satisfied with the installation options. Because of the size of the program, installation can take up to 20 minutes on slower computers. You may opt to register your software once the process completes.
- 6). Restart your computer before using After Effects for the first time.
